ci(jslib): publish jslib whenever version is bumped
ci/woodpecker/push/woodpecker Pipeline was successful Details

feat/lang-upgrades-keys
Tomáš Mládek 2023-10-09 22:29:49 +02:00
parent bf223cf247
commit 44e1d1687a
2 changed files with 6 additions and 3 deletions

View File

@ -158,5 +158,3 @@ pipeline:
- mkdir ~/.earthly && echo "$EARTHLY_CONFIGURATION" > ~/.earthly/config.yaml
- earthly bootstrap
- earthly --push --secret NPM_TOKEN +publish-jslib
when:
event: [tag]

View File

@ -165,7 +165,12 @@ publish-jslib:
RUN --secret NPM_TOKEN echo "//registry.npmjs.org/:_authToken=$NPM_TOKEN" > $HOME/.npmrc
COPY +jslib/jslib tools/upend_js
WORKDIR tools/upend_js
RUN --push npm publish --access public
IF [ "`npm view @upnd/upend version`" != "`node -p \"require('./package.json').version\"`" ]
RUN echo yeah
RUN --push npm publish --access public
ELSE
RUN echo "Nothing to do."
END
git-version:
LOCALLY